Securing Social Security Disability benefits can be a complex process. Numerous individuals face difficulties when navigating the application system. It's essential to understand the criteria and comply them thoroughly.
First, you need to determine your eligibility. This involves demonstrating that your medical condition impedes you from working and is expected to last at least twelve months or result in death.
To start the application process, you can file an application online, by mail, or by reaching out to your local Social Security office.
- Ensure to gather all necessary documentation, such as medical records, employment records, and any other relevant information.
- Keep detailed records of your communications with Social Security, including dates, times, and the names of representatives you talk to.
- Explore seeking legal assistance from a qualified disability attorney if challenges arise. They can assist you through the complex process and represent your rights.
Navigating Social Security Disability benefits can be difficult, but by remaining informed and organized, you can increase your chances of a successful outcome.

Comprehending Social Security Disability Criteria
Applying for Social Security Disability benefits can be a complex journey. To qualify, you must meet strict criteria set by the Social Security Administration (SSA). These rules are designed to verify that only individuals with severe and long-term disabilities receive benefits.
One of the primary determinants considered is the severity of your ailment. The SSA evaluates your medical evidence to determine if your disability significantly restricts your ability to work.
Another crucial factor is the period of your disability. To qualify, your ailment must be expected to check here last at least one year or result in death. The SSA also considers your past work history and capacity to perform various duties.
This system can be quite complex, so it's essential to gather all necessary proof and seek guidance from an experienced disability advocate or attorney.
